The 16 October local government ordinary elections are just seven weeks away, so the DLGSC local government team has been out delivering information sessions to local people interested in standing for council.

Julie Craig and Issy Rule were out at the City of Cockburn on 25 August, talking on the topics of what to expect when you’re elected, and the values required of an elected member.

Earlier in the week, Jodie Holbrook delivered a session at Rockingham, while Shannon Wood and Marina Sucur paid a visit to the City of Belmont.

They were joined by representatives from WALGA and the WA Electoral Commission (WAEC). More information sessions will take place, co-hosted by WAEC.

Earlier this month, DLGSC with the Office of Multicultural Interests (OMI) held a session for members of culturally and linguistically diverse communities. For more information, contact OMI

Nominations for the October elections open on 2 September and close on 9 September.
